摘要:統(tǒng)計(jì)當(dāng)前頁(yè)面含有多少個(gè)標(biāo)簽當(dāng)前頁(yè)面存在的標(biāo)簽個(gè)數(shù)為原生統(tǒng)計(jì)頁(yè)面所有標(biāo)簽的種類存儲(chǔ)標(biāo)簽的種類以及相應(yīng)的個(gè)數(shù)
統(tǒng)計(jì)當(dāng)前頁(yè)面含有多少個(gè)標(biāo)簽ES6
const domNames = Array.form(document.querySelectorAll("*")).map(v => v.tagName); const result = new Set(domNames); console.log(`當(dāng)前頁(yè)面存在的標(biāo)簽個(gè)數(shù)為: ${result.size}`);JS
const dom = document.querySelectorAll("*"); const domNames = []; Array.from(dom).forEach(v => { domNames.push(v.tagName); }); const obj = {}; const newArr = []; domNames.forEach(name => { if(!obj[name]) { newArr.push(name); obj[name] = true; } }); console.log(newArr.length);原生JS統(tǒng)計(jì)頁(yè)面所有標(biāo)簽的種類
var all = document.querySelectorAll("*"); var tags = []; all.forEach(item => { tags.push(item.tagName.toLocaleLowerCase()); }); // 存儲(chǔ)標(biāo)簽的種類以及相應(yīng)的個(gè)數(shù) var result = {}; for(var i = 0; i < tags.length; i++) { if(!result[tags[i]]) { result[tags[i]] = 1; } else { result[tags[i]]++; } } console.log(res); console.log(Reflect.ownKeys(res).length);
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/103245.html
摘要:歡迎大家收看聊一聊系列,這一套系列文章,可以幫助前端工程師們了解前端的方方面面不僅僅是代碼什么是功能統(tǒng)計(jì)作為一名開發(fā),我們的產(chǎn)品發(fā)布出去之后,無(wú)論是產(chǎn)品還是運(yùn)營(yíng),其實(shí)都是想及時(shí)了解產(chǎn)品對(duì)用戶產(chǎn)生的影響的。下一章,我們將繼續(xù)聊聊速度統(tǒng)計(jì)。 歡迎大家收看聊一聊系列,這一套系列文章,可以幫助前端工程師們了解前端的方方面面(不僅僅是代碼):https://segmentfault.com/bl...
摘要:歡迎大家收看聊一聊系列,這一套系列文章,可以幫助前端工程師們了解前端的方方面面不僅僅是代碼什么是功能統(tǒng)計(jì)作為一名開發(fā),我們的產(chǎn)品發(fā)布出去之后,無(wú)論是產(chǎn)品還是運(yùn)營(yíng),其實(shí)都是想及時(shí)了解產(chǎn)品對(duì)用戶產(chǎn)生的影響的。下一章,我們將繼續(xù)聊聊速度統(tǒng)計(jì)。 歡迎大家收看聊一聊系列,這一套系列文章,可以幫助前端工程師們了解前端的方方面面(不僅僅是代碼):https://segmentfault.com/bl...
摘要:所以我已經(jīng)將服務(wù)遷移至上,有興趣的同學(xué)請(qǐng)移步最新的一篇博文博客訪問(wèn)量統(tǒng)計(jì)工具查看最新版本的使用方法。但是針對(duì)博客的訪問(wèn)量統(tǒng)計(jì),卻沒(méi)有什么可用的工具。 本文最初發(fā)布于我的個(gè)人博客:咀嚼之味 2016.04.23 通告: Hit Kounter 原本部署于 SAE 上,而近期 SAE 針對(duì)使用 MySQL 的應(yīng)用開始收費(fèi)。本項(xiàng)目只是一個(gè)本人使用業(yè)余時(shí)間開發(fā)的小工具;它本身包含的功能也很精...
閱讀 3221·2021-09-30 09:48
閱讀 3497·2021-09-22 16:00
閱讀 1071·2019-08-30 13:08
閱讀 3110·2019-08-30 10:53
閱讀 2422·2019-08-29 18:33
閱讀 1596·2019-08-29 12:47
閱讀 904·2019-08-29 12:16
閱讀 1935·2019-08-26 12:02